Structure of Web Content Management System (WCMS) PDF Print E-mail

This is a brief structure of Web Content Management System (WCMS):

  • Front End & Back End - The front end is where the website users & the visitors use and see.  The back end is the administration layer for the administrators.
  • Access Right - The websire displays different content based on the access rights such as a registered usr, author, editor and super administrator.
  • Content - It can be various forms such as text, a picture, a link, a music file, an application, RSS feeds, and newsfeeds etc.
  • Extensions - components, modules, plug-ins and templates
  • Components - Componets are extensions that offer additional functionalities.
  • Plug-ins - It is a programming code which is appended at certain places in the Joomla framework to change its functionality.
  • Templates - It is a visual editing pattern that is placed on the top of content.
  • Workflow - a sequence of operations.

What is Content Management System (CMS) PDF Print E-mail

According to Wikepedia's definition,  Content Management System (abbreviated as CMS) is "a computer software system used to enable and organize the joint process of creating and editing text and multimedia documents (content)."

 

In other words, a CMS (also referred as a "Web management system") is software or a group or suite of applications & tools that enable an individual or a group of people (such as company employees) to seamlessly create, edit, review and publish electronic text.  A CMS allows website owners to publish new content to their web sites. 

 

A CMS is mainly designed for Web publishing, and it will provide options and features to index and search documents and specify keywords and other metadata for search engine crawlers.

 
How to Change Default Article Order in a Category PDF Print E-mail

Joomla'sdefault order of the articlesin a specific category are by date created. To change the order to ascending alphabetical order like A to Z (but leave other categories as it is), you need to set the order of the specific category using the parameters.

  1. Go to Menu > Mainmenu > Advanced Parameters
  2. Set the Primary order from default to Title (Alphabetical)
